Photo: genotar1/ Adobe StockAluminum fences are low upkeep, solid, and simple to install, making them an excellent choice for a large range of fencing installment tasks. Because light weight aluminum is light-weight and malleable, installers can construct it on either a level or sloped lawn. It's also both discolor- and moisture-resistant.


Frequently, aluminum secure fencing comes criterion with spacing between the posts, making this a less suitable option if you're looking for even more personal privacy and safety and security. Nevertheless, if you're seeking a visually enticing way to area off your home, this is an excellent choice for an ambitious do it yourself job. ProsConsLong lifespanLimited privacyLightweightPosts flex easilyDIY availableHigher costLow maintenanceNot weather condition resistantBest for: Homeowners seeking a long-lasting choice where privacy isn't a worry.

Related Post Image: Cavan Images/ Cavan/ Getty ImagesChain web link fence is a tried-and-true means to area off your residential property and create a barrier of access.


Fence ContractorFence Contractor
Chain link fence covering is a preferred option for consisting of animals or youngsters and specifying residential property lines in your yard. While several sorts of chain web link fencings are bare steel, black chain link fences have a plastic finish. They tend to look even more classy than conventional chain web link fencings. ProsConsAffordableLess secureEasy installationLimited privacyLow maintenanceLow resale valueBest for: House owners searching for a fundamental fencing to keep pet dogs and kids safe.
